基于Simulink的异步电机动态仿真建模与分析系统
项目介绍
本项目是一个基于MATLAB/Simulink平台开发的三相异步电机动态性能仿真与分析系统。通过建立异步电机在d-q旋转坐标系下的完整数学模型,实现了电机在各种运行工况下的高精度仿真。系统采用模块化设计,提供参数化配置接口,支持多种控制策略仿真,并能够自动生成电机运行特性曲线和性能分析报告。
功能特性
- 完整数学模型:包含电磁转矩方程、电压方程和运动方程的异步电机动态模型
- 多工况仿真:支持起动过程(直接起动/降压起动)、负载变化、调速运行等动态性能分析
- 参数化配置:可灵活设置电机额定参数(功率、电压、频率、电阻、电感等)和控制参数
- 控制策略仿真:集成V/F控制、矢量控制等多种电机控制方法
- 全面分析功能:自动生成转矩-转速特性、电流特性、效率特性等曲线,计算关键性能指标
使用方法
- 参数设置:在图形界面或配置文件中输入电机参数、控制参数和仿真参数
- 工况选择:设置初始状态、负载曲线和控制模式等运行条件
- 仿真执行:运行主程序启动Simulink仿真,系统自动进行模型计算
- 结果分析:查看生成的时域波形和特性曲线,分析性能指标报告
- 数据导出:保存仿真数据和分析结果用于进一步处理
系统要求
- MATLAB R2018b或更高版本
- Simulink基础模块库
- Simscape Electrical(原名SimPowerSystems)工具箱
- 推荐内存:4GB以上
- 磁盘空间:至少1GB可用空间
文件说明
主程序文件负责协调整个仿真系统的运行流程,具备参数初始化、模型配置、仿真执行和结果处理等核心功能。具体包括设置电机与控制参数、构建并调用Simulink仿真模型、监控仿真过程、提取关键变量数据、绘制特性曲线图表、计算性能指标以及生成分析报告与数据文件。